## Formula sandbox tuning

User-supplied formulas in Gridmoor execute inside a restricted interpreter with hard ceilings on time, memory, and call depth. Reviewers should confirm any change to these ceilings is justified in the PR description, since raising them widens the abuse surface. Defaults were chosen from production traces. The current limits are as follows.

limits module of tafog-fawip:
WEIGHTS = {
    "julix": 57,
    "lamys": 992,
    "kasvan": 209,
    "quenok": 750,
    "alddor": 259,
    "oliath": 1009,
    "wenix": 815,
}

Welcome to the Tendril calendar team. A known quirk: when Tendril syncs against the Meetwell backend, overlapping events from two sources can double-write unless the conflict resolver is enabled. When reviewing sync PRs, check that writes go through `ConflictGate` and never directly to the store. To run the resolver locally, set up `.env.local`, and add the Meetwell service token on the following line.

vault entry, kafog-yahop: COURIER_KEY8=0faa53ae

TURN-208: Gatevale turnstile counters at the Merrow Field pilot double-count when a rotation reverses mid-cycle. Attendance totals drift roughly 2% high per event. The debounce window fix is implemented, reviewed by Ilsa, and soak-tested across two simulated match days without drift. Ready for your cut; the candidate build is identified below.

trace token, tagag-tafog: htk6_5ed18c

Quarterly Planning Note — Finance Team

The Lumenfall launch is confirmed for early Q3. Tooling spend lands in Q2, marketing in Q3, with first revenue expected six weeks post-launch. Please model a conservative and an aggressive uptake case by month-end. Velda will circulate unit cost assumptions separately. One item must stay within this team.

internal memo for kaduf-baduf: Only 35 of the 378 pilot accounts renewed Holir, so a churn review is set for June 11. Eliielax Group is in early talks to buy Silaelix Group for about $142.1 million.